Excellent PCM audio quality from 32kHz to 192kHz Excellent MQA Rendering quality to beyond 384kHz Ultra-low phase noise conversion clocking Outputs can connect directly to power amplifiers All metal Series 3 IR Remote Control Available with a Silver or Black front panel Controls & Indicators Input selects AES, SPDIF1, SPDIF2 or Toslink inputs Lock LED indicates input signal lock HDCD LED indicates HDCD code detected Phase sets the absolute phase Invert LED indicates absolute phase inverted 3 digit LED display of Stereo/L/R attenuation, Sampling Rate and Filter type ± controls set attenuation level and select Filter type Mode selects Stereo/L/R attenuation, Sampling Rate and Filter type display modes Dim selects multiple display brightness levels Specifications Input sampling rate: 32kHz to 192kHz Input word length: 24-bit Ultra-low phase noise Precision Clocking at 44.1kHz, 48kHz, 88.2kHz, 96kHz, 176.4kHz and 192kHz sampling rates ± 100 ppm Two channel analog stereo outputs: XLR balanced with pin 2 positive and RCA unbalanced Digital Inputs: AES - XLR, 110Ω; SPDIF1 - BNC, 75Ω; SPDIF2 - BNC, 75Ω; TOSLINK - Toslink optical connector MQA rendering automatically detects MQA Core decoded signals and performs MQA rendering to 384kHz and above HDCD decoding detects 16-bit flag at 44.1kHz or 24-bit flag at all sampling rates Multiple digital filter options Balanced analog output level: +18dBu (6.15Vrms) maximum, +12dBu (3.1Vrms) or lower recommended Unbalanced analog output level: 3.25Vrms maximum, 2Vrms or lower recommended Digital volume & balance control: 0.1dB/step with .05dB/step L/R gain trim, 60dB range Frequency response at ≥ 88.2kHz sampling rates: ± 0.1dB from < 0.1Hz to 35 kHz, - 3dB at 59kHz for 176.4kHz and 192kHz sampling rates Distortion at recommended levels: all products ≤ -120dBFS THD+N at maximum level: < -110dBFS Firmware is upgradeable through signal inputs Enclosure dimensions: 2.3”H X 16.7”W x 10.6”D Weight: 11.6 lbs. Mains power: 100/120/240VAC, 50/60Hz Power consumption: 25W
